rain shadow (noun) — An area on the leeward region of a mountain that’s dry because it is sheltered from rain-bearing winds.
An area on the leeward region of a mountain that’s dry because it is sheltered from rain-bearing winds. (The mountain creates a “shadow” of dryness.) These areas tend to contain less lush than the regions on their windward sides.
